NEARLY ALL DOUBLE

NEW POSTAL RATES ALL LETTERS TO PAY 2D Is MINIMUM FOR. TELEGRAMS (Per Press Association.) WELLINGTON, this day. The new postal and telegraph charges are announced. Briefly, the changes are as follows : Letters, 2d, instead of Id. Post cards, Id, instead of id. Late fee, 2d, instead of Id. Packets, Id for eacii 40z., instead of Ad for each 2oz. up to 21b., and 2d a lb. thereafter. Newspapers, Id for each Boz., instead of i<l per copy. Registration fee, 4d, instead of 3d. Parcels, 6d a lb. for the first 21b., and 3d a lb. thereafter up to 111 b. Fragile fees of 6d and 9d on parcels are doubled. Telegrams are increased to Id a word, with a. minimum of Is, with urgents at double that rate. Night letter telegrams will be charged Is for 24 words. Radio telegrams will be increased from 5d and lOd a word to 6d and lid. The press rate of Is 6<l per 100 words will remain, but a limit of 6000 words will he imposed on press messages for morning papers lodged after 5 p.m. For evening papers the limit after 5 p.m. is fixed at 1000 words, words in excess of those maxima being charged for at the rate of £d each.
